R တွင် complete.cases ကိုအသုံးပြုနည်း (ဥပမာများနှင့်အတူ)


vector၊ matrix သို့မဟုတ် data frame တစ်ခုရှိ ပျောက်ဆုံးနေသောတန်ဖိုးများကို ဖယ်ရှားရန် R ရှိ complete.cases() လုပ်ဆောင်ချက်ကို သင်အသုံးပြုနိုင်ပါသည်။

ဤလုပ်ဆောင်ချက်သည် အောက်ပါအခြေခံ syntax ကိုအသုံးပြုသည်-

 #remove missing values from vector
x <- x[complete. boxes (x)]

#remove rows with missing values in any column of data frame
df <- df[complete. boxes (df), ]

#remove rows with NA in specific columns of data frame
df <- df[complete. cases (df[, c(' col1 ', ' col2 ', ...)]), ] 

အောက်ဖော်ပြပါ ဥပမာများသည် ဤလုပ်ဆောင်ချက်ကို လက်တွေ့အသုံးချနည်းကို ပြသထားသည်။

ဥပမာ 1: ပျောက်ဆုံးနေသောတန်ဖိုးများကို vector မှဖယ်ရှားပါ။

အောက်ပါကုဒ်သည် vector တစ်ခုမှ NA တန်ဖိုးအားလုံးကို ဖယ်ရှားနည်းကို ပြသသည်-

 #definevector
x <- c(1, 24, NA, 6, NA, 9)

#remove NA values from vector
x <- x[complete. boxes (x)]

x

[1] 1 24 6 9

ဥပမာ 2- ဒေတာဘောင်၏ မည်သည့်ကော်လံတွင် NA ပါသော အတန်းများကို ဖျက်ပါ။

အောက်ပါကုဒ်သည် ဒေတာဘောင်တစ်ခု၏ မည်သည့်ကော်လံတွင် NA တန်ဖိုးများပါသည့် အတန်းများကို ဖယ်ရှားနည်းကို ပြသသည်-

 #define data frame
df <- data. frame (x=c(1, 24, NA, 6, NA, 9),
                 y=c(NA, 3, 4, 8, NA, 12),
                 z=c(NA, 7, 5, 15, 7, 14))

#view data frame
df

   X Y Z
1 1 NA NA
2 24 3 7
3 NA 4 5
4 6 8 15
5 NA NA 7
6 9 12 14

#remove rows with NA value in any column data frame
df <- df[complete. boxes (df), ]

#view data frame 
df

   X Y Z
2 24 3 7
4 6 8 15
6 9 12 14

ဥပမာ 3- ဒေတာဘောင်၏ သီးခြားကော်လံများတွင် NA ပါသော အတန်းများကို ဖျက်ပါ။

အောက်ပါကုဒ်သည် ဒေတာဘောင်တစ်ခု၏ သီးခြားကော်လံများတွင် NA တန်ဖိုးများပါသည့် အတန်းများကို ဖျက်နည်းကို ပြသသည်-

 #define data frame
df <- data. frame (x=c(1, 24, NA, 6, NA, 9),
                 y=c(NA, 3, 4, 8, NA, 12),
                 z=c(NA, 7, 5, 15, 7, 14))

#view data frame
df

   X Y Z
1 1 NA NA
2 24 3 7
3 NA 4 5
4 6 8 15
5 NA NA 7
6 9 12 14

#remove rows with NA value in y or z column
df <- df[complete. cases (df[, c(' y ', ' z ')]), ]

#view data frame 
df

   X Y Z
2 24 3 7
3 NA 4 5
4 6 8 15
6 9 12 14

ထပ်လောင်းအရင်းအမြစ်များ

R တွင် “ Is Not NA” ကိုအသုံးပြုနည်း
R တွင် ပျောက်ဆုံးနေသောတန်ဖိုးများအားလုံးကို မည်သို့အပြစ်တင်မည်နည်း။
NA ကို R တွင် ကြိုးများဖြင့် အစားထိုးနည်း

မှတ်ချက်တစ်ခုထည့်ပါ။

သင့် email လိပ်စာကို ဖော်ပြမည် မဟုတ်ပါ။ လိုအပ်သော ကွက်လပ်များကို * ဖြင့်မှတ်သားထားသည်